How do I tell my interviewer about my internship?
Intern interview question #1: Tell us a bit about yourself. We suggest making three brief points along the lines of: 1) your year of study and degree subject; 2) your career aim or what career you’re interested in; 3) a hobby or interest that you pursue in your spare time.
How do you talk about internship in an interview?
Talk about technical and professionalism skills you learned and/or developed. Highlight one main accomplishment you had during the internship. 30 Seconds – Focus on your main learning from the experience and how this might impact you professionally and as you make future career decisions.

Is it hard to get a return offer from an internship?
Sort of. It’s not the end of the world, but failing to get a return offer from an internship can make it a lot harder to start a career in finance. And it’s incredibly frustrating because your return offer, or lack thereof, often relates more to office politics or deal activity than your performance.
